Satoru Nagao appears on IPDCI News, an organization focused on advancing the principles of the United Nations, to discuss Russia’s war crimes.

Caption
(Getty Images)
Satoru Nagao appears on IPDCI News, an organization focused on advancing the principles of the United Nations, to discuss Russia’s war crimes.